## v2.8.3 — Quillport Auth Service

- Fixed session-token refresh bug: tokens refreshed within 60 seconds of expiry were silently invalidated, forcing re-login.
- Refresh window now grace-extended by 120 seconds.
- No config changes needed; contractors can pull latest and redeploy staging as usual.

Questions on this fix go to the engineer named below.

account owner for bawip-tahag: Raleth Quenok

Ticket: LogLoupe viewer can't pull audit events

Heads up — the credential the LogLoupe audit-log viewer uses against the internal EventVault service expired over the weekend, so the compliance dashboard has been blank since Saturday. Nothing nefarious, just nobody set a rotation reminder. I've provisioned a replacement with the same read-only scope; please confirm the scope looks sane before we close this out. The new credential for the viewer is below.

service key, fawip-bajef: kto11_Qt5wZK9vdNC

**Item 12 — Export memory check.** Before sealing the signing keys, plugin authors must confirm their Tallygrid export hooks stream rows instead of buffering whole sheets. Run the harness against a 500k-row workbook; peak RSS must stay under 1.2 GB. Exports that materialize the full grid in memory will be rejected at review. Log the measured peak in the ceremony record. To open the attestation vault for logging, enter the recovery passphrase noted below.

unlock words, hahip-baduf: holwyn-istath-julvan

// FUEL_REPORT_WINDOW_DAYS sets the rollup window for the Hauldex fleet
// fuel-usage report shown at the weekly eng sync. Keep it at 7 unless
// the depot telemetry backlog clears; longer windows double query cost
// on the metering cluster. Vehicles flagged `retired` are excluded at
// ingest, not here. Changing this constant invalidates cached rollups,
// so expect the first sync after a change to show a recompute delay.
// Reports generated against nonstandard windows must cite the build
// token recorded on the following line.

pipeline stamp: htk31_f769b577b3028a4e9958e5bb8d1259a